What are Modular Homes?

Modular homes, also known as prefabricated homes, are residential structures built in sections in a factory setting. They are then transported to the building site and assembled on a permanent foundation. But wait, aren’t these just fancy mobile homes? No, not quite. Let’s delve a bit into their evolution.

Evolution of Modular Homes

Modular homes have come a long way since their inception. The concept began as an offshoot of the mobile home industry but quickly evolved to incorporate design, quality, and energy efficiency that rivals, and sometimes even surpasses, traditional on-site construction.

Benefits of Modular Homes in Los Angeles

Affordability

One of the key advantages of modular homes is their affordability. Given that construction occurs in a controlled factory environment, costs are significantly reduced.

Customization Options

With modular homes Los Angeles, you can truly make your home your own. Numerous design options are available, ranging from floor plans to finishes, allowing you to create a home that reflects your unique style and needs.

Sustainability and Energy Efficiency

Modular homes Los Angeles are built with sustainability in mind. Materials are recycled in the factory, and energy-efficient designs help homeowners reduce their carbon footprint.

Quick Construction Time

Modular homes can be completed in a fraction of the time required for traditional homes, thanks to the efficiency of factory production and the simultaneous site preparation.

FAQs

1. How long does it take to build a modular home in Los Angeles?

Typically, a modular home can be built and ready for move-in within a few months, depending on the complexity of the design and site preparation.

2. Can I customize my modular home?

Absolutely! One of the major benefits of modular homes is the flexibility to customize the design, layout, and finishes to suit your personal taste and lifestyle.

3. Are modular homes as durable as traditional homes?

Yes, modular homes are built to the same building codes as traditional homes and often exceed these standards due to the precision of factory construction.

4. Are modular homes energy efficient?

Yes, many modular homes are designed with energy efficiency in mind, incorporating features such as high-quality insulation, energy-efficient appliances, and solar panels.

5. Can I build a modular home anywhere in Los Angeles?

Most residential zones in Los Angeles allow for modular homes. However, it’s always important to check local zoning laws and regulations before proceeding with a modular home project.
